THE NEIGHBOUR by Ashok Sukumaran opens 13 March 2009
Latest Events
Bombay-based Ashok Sukumaran is one of the few artists in the world making work that directly addresses the issues of infrastructure in cities, electricity, water supply and other essential services. He produces startling public artworks that involve entire communities. This March he presents The Neighbour in P3, the massive construction halls buried deep under the University of Westminster in central London. Presented by The Arts Catalyst and P3, The Neighbour opens on 13 March 2009.Write Comment (0 comments)

SOUTHBANK CENTRE JOINS WITH MAJOR ARTISTS AND KEY UK-BASED SOUTH ASIAN CULTURAL ORGANISATIONS
TV & Events
Picture of A R Rahman

TO LAUNCH NEW FESTIVAL OF INDIAN CULTURE

ALCHEMY

WEDNESDAY 7 – SUNDAY 11 APRIL 2010

On 7 – 11 April, Southbank Centre launches Alchemy, a major new festival celebrating contemporary and traditional culture from India. With a full programme of music, dance, literature, food, debate and fashion, events range from a rare classical concert by celebrated composer A.R. Rahman to the very best UK bhangra, to an evening of music and chat with The Grewal Family from Channel 4’s hit documentary The Family. Add to that free classical and folk dance workshops, early morning yoga, the Alchemy Market and an immersive installation that recreates the sights and sounds of Southall, this five-day festival will take over all venues and spaces of Southbank Centre.

Slumdog Millionaire doodles for charity
Latest Events
Dev Patel

Hundreds of celebrities will be showing their artistic side for charity as part of this year's National Doodle Day. Doodles by celebrities including Slumdog Millionaire actor Dev Patel, comedian Shazia Mirza and Eastenders regulars Nitin Ganatra and Marc Elliott will be auctioned on eBay from Friday 5 March. The auction will raise money for two UK neurological charities, Epilepsy Action and The Neurofibromatosis Association.

The Idea Generation Gallery presents Ray Lowry: London Calling 18th June – 4th July
Latest Events

The Clash Album Cover Manchester—born, Lowry began his career drawing for Punch Magazine, International Times, OZ, NME and Private Eye, generating a cult following for his celebrated illustrations and cartoons. Most famously, Lowry created the unforgettable art work for The Clash’s seminal 1979 album, London Calling. Followed by many devoted fans, Lowry and his work have been cited as an influence by a broad spectrum of artists from John Squire to Arthur Smith, Keith Allen to Paul Simonon (of The Clash) and Tracey Emin to Humphrey Ocean.
